OpenAI Launches First ChatGPT Ads in UK, Expands Global Reach with New Pilot
  • The UK move is part of a broader plan to roll out ads to Japan, South Korea, Brazil, and Mexico soon, with the UK as the first concrete international activation.

  • OpenAI has launched a live ChatGPT advertising pilot in the United Kingdom, marking the platform’s first non-North American ads activation.

  • This rollout follows a rapid series of product and policy updates from late 2025 into mid-2026, culminating in the UK activation on June 6, 2026.

  • As the pilot scales, OpenAI is tracking trust metrics, dismissal rates, and ad relevance, building on US results that showed no drop in trust, low dismissal, and improving relevance.

  • A growing ecosystem of ad tech partners and measurement tools supports the UK launch, with plans to expand geographically and feature set.

  • The UK rollout faces regulatory and measurement considerations unique to the market, including data privacy norms and scrutiny from the Advertising Standards Authority, to test if US benchmarks transfer.

  • The UK launch comes as the US pilot accelerates commercially, hitting over $100 million in annualized revenue within six weeks and shifting toward a self-serve Ads Manager with CPC bidding and broader targeting.

  • The ad policy rests on five principles: mission alignment, answer independence, conversation privacy, long-term value, and user choice, with ads clearly separated and labeled.

  • Ads are shown only to users on Free and Go tiers; Plus, Pro, and Enterprise subscribers will remain ad-free in line with OpenAI’s paid, ad-free option.
